Former B.C. MP endorses redevelopment plan for Royal York Golf Course
Course would become executive length with 'needed' homes
February 3, 2021 By Castanet.net
A former Member of Parliament for Okanagan-Shuswap has endorsed the proposed redevelopment of the Royal York Golf Course in Armstrong, B.C. Darrel Stinson acknowledged that many golf courses are struggling, but said converting the course to executive length while developing “much-needed” residential homes equates to a “viable plan.”
